Skip to content.
Job Title: Java Developer (Golang) Contract: 6 months (Inside IR35) - Extendable Location: Hybrid (2-3 days per week on-site) Rate: DOE Client: Leading Financial Services Organisation Overview A leading financial services client is seeking an experienced Java Developer with strong Golang exposure to join a critical engineering programme. This role will focus on building and enhancing high-performance Back End services within a modern, cloud-based architecture. You'll be working alongside senior engineers on scalable, resilient systems that support business-critical platforms, with a strong... more ->
Key Responsibilities: Design and develop Back End services using Java and Golang Build and maintain microservices-based architecture Develop RESTful APIs and integrate third-party services Work with databases (SQL/NoSQL) and ensure performance optimization Collaborate with cross-functional teams (DevOps, QA, Product) Write clean, scalable, and well-documented code Participate in code reviews and system design discussions Required Skills: Strong hands-on experience in Java (Spring Boot, Microservices) Working experience in Golang Experience with REST APIs , JSON, HTTP Knowledge of Docker &... more ->
Design, develop, and maintain Back End applications using Java and Kotlin Build and consume RESTful APIs and Microservices Collaborate with product owners, architects, and cross-functional teams Write clean, maintainable, and well-tested code Perform code reviews and ensure adherence to best practices Troubleshoot production issues and optimize application peformance Required Skills: Strong experience in Core Java (Java 8+) Hands-on experience with Kotlin for Back End development Solid experience with Spring/Spring Boot Good understanding of Microservices architecture Experience with... more ->